Auxiliary door installation services involve adding or replacing secondary doors within a property to enhance access, security, or functionality. These services typically include installing doors in areas such as garages, basements, or side entrances, as well as creating additional access points in existing structures. Professionals conducting these installations ensure that the doors are properly fitted, aligned, and secured to provide smooth operation and reliable performance. The process often involves assessing the existing structure, selecting appropriate door types, and ensuring compatibility with the property's design and security needs.

These services help address a variety of common problems, including inadequate access points, security concerns, and energy inefficiencies. For example, properties that lack a convenient secondary entrance may benefit from an auxiliary door to improve accessibility. Additionally, auxiliary doors can serve as a barrier to prevent unauthorized entry or to create a controlled entry point that enhances overall security. Proper installation can also prevent drafts, leaks, or heat loss, contributing to better energy efficiency within the building.

Properties that typically utilize auxiliary door installation services vary widely in type and size. Residential homes often require secondary doors for garages, basements, or side yards, providing convenient access and added security. Commercial buildings may also need auxiliary doors to facilitate employee or customer entry, improve emergency egress, or meet building code requirements. Additionally, multi-family dwellings, such as apartment complexes, frequently incorporate secondary doors to serve individual units or shared common areas, ensuring safe and efficient access for residents.

The overview below groups typical Auxiliary Door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Essex,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Design Costs - The cost of auxiliary door installation can vary based on door material and design, typically ranging from $300 to $1,200.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while custom or premium options are more expensive.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ing an auxiliary door generally fall between $150 and $600, depending on the complexity of the installation and local labor rates. Additional work, such as wall modifications, may increase overall costs.

Additional Materials - Expenses for hardware, seals, and other materials usually range from $50 to $200. These costs depend on the door type and quality of materials selected by local service providers.

Overall Project Budget - Total costs for auxiliary door installation typically range from $500 to $2,000, with variations based on door specifications, site conditions, and regional pricing differences.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an auxiliary door? An auxiliary door is a secondary door installed to provide additional access or egress, often used for convenience or safety purposes.

Where can auxiliary doors be installed? They can be installed in various locations such as garages, basements, or side entrances, depending on the property’s layout and needs.

What types of auxiliary doors are available? Options include standard hinged doors, sliding doors, and folding doors, made from materials like wood, metal, or composite.

How long does auxiliary door installation typically take? Installation times vary based on the door type and property specifics, but most projects can be completed within a day or two.
